After another conversation with my father, we decided to strike earlier. He secretly sent out a squadron of his own elites to take down the demon faction while he himself rooted out the spies in the Magician’s Tower as well as the court. However, while the demon faction’s base was obliterated, there were no demons around and all research had disappeared. The only thing left of them are the few captives my father’s men took and a room full of broken glass containers, each big enough to hold one person.
Since the last conversation between Prince and Dorian Mannes, no one has spoken in that room, leaving me with no more intelligence to gather at the moment. It makes me think that Prince knows it was bugged. Meanwhile, Cordelia left to find Teacher Broffenberg after telling me to search for the spirits. Her words keep repeating in my head, but where do I even start to search for them?
Annoyed, I heave a sigh before remembering that I’m still in class. The teacher shoots me a look of disdain. “Miss Allandis, if you find this class that boring, you may leave.”
Standing up, I glance at my notebook and read a few lines, saying, “Apologies, Professor. I just don’t quite understand the connection between jam stones and mana. I know that they void all magic, but why is that?”
Hearing this, the teacher’s gaze softens. “The world is about balance. Jam stones are created as the neutralizer, since mana is destructive by nature. Jam stones naturally draw in the power of mana to work, redirecting mana into them from the surrounding air, hence why once they are activated, they cannot be deactivated.”
“Then if the nature of the mana used was different, would jam stones not be rendered ineffective?”
“While this is a theory yet to be proven, any attempts to change the nature of mana have been outlawed due to the serious side effects of those who have attempted this in the past.”
“Side effects?”
“Exactly so. The side effect of forcefully changing the nature of mana is demonization. Mana can go out of control much quicker if one forcefully changes its nature.”
Advertisement
“But Professor, if the nature is successfully changed, why would mana still go out of control?”
“This is because the unnatural change in mana causes it to be less stable, as it wants to return to its original nature. This is the reason why mana cannot be used through any language other than the magi language.”
“Does using another language not work?” Teacher Broffenberg taught me otherwise.
“If another language is used, the nature of mana changes. This is why it is so inefficient, since the amount of mana needed for a spell is exponentially higher.”
“Thank you.” I sit back down before my questions lead the teacher further astray from her lesson. As soon as class ends, I pack up and head out the door.
